Went along as a neutral tonight. Thought Falkirk dominated the first half but had no cutting edge. Second half Dunfermline were much better and showed more aggression which got them the points comfortably in the end.  Helped by Falkirk self destructing after conceding the first goal obviously. 

Falkirk felt very reminiscent of McGlynn’s Rovers a lot of the time. Nice passing and moving . Good to watch but with little end result. Fades when a team takes the game to them and doesn’t let them stroke it around. And absolutely no Plan B when they concede. 

Will be good to have the Fife derby back next year. Assuming we don’t implode.
